2005 Mustang GT... Accidentally shifted into 2nd at 80+... Did I damage anything??
I was just wondering if any one else has had this happen.Last night while racing an old Chevelle,when shifting from 3rd to 4th for some reason it goes into 2nd gear doing almost 85-95 mph.When I letting out the clutch the rear tires chirpped like if i hit the e-brake and I pushed in the clutch and went to 4th gear.I know the engine reved to probablly red line approx?Does anyone think I caused any damage or messed something up? p.s. The rev. limiter is only good for an electronic safety under power. You can still over speed the motor with by mechanically pushing the motor by down shifting like that. I'm not saying he did any damage but you can if your not carefull
